logo

Output 90e6e74260b759f0593c16ae3a4b80e9c359937c51ee8bcd97b419668a19e806:0

value
2655000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ed62518a4b4e010c3c984aedc37071301b3af93 OP_EQUAL
address
3K64r3JdCf8ZwSMWp7QFa5Z5fkZCxTJi7N
transaction
90e6e74260b759f0593c16ae3a4b80e9c359937c51ee8bcd97b419668a19e806